Objective Lenses Magnification. Objective lenses can uniquely make small objects look much more significant. Total magnification = objective magnification x ocular magnification. More highly corrected objectives have inscriptions such as apochromat or apo, plan, fl, fluor, etc. The scanning objective lens usually has 4x magnification and can be identified by a red strip band around the perimeter of the lens.
